Game Introduction
Carnival Duck Point Quest is a lighthearted HTML5 game that recreates the classic carnival point quest experience. Players are placed in a colorful fairground setting where they aim at moving targets. The objective is to select the mischievous ducks and fish that appear on screen to earn points, while being careful not to target the peaceful geese. Selecting a goose will reduce your score, so precision and quick thinking are important. How to Play
Players typically use their mouse or touch screen to aim and select targets that move across the screen. The goal is to hit the ducks and fish to earn points, but you must avoid selecting the geese, as doing so will reduce your score. The game is easy to learn, making it accessible for beginners and experienced players alike. Keep an eye on the moving targets and try to achieve a high score by hitting as many ducks and fish as possible. The game ends when you miss too many targets or hit too many geese, so staying focused is key.
